Backfill installation services involve the process of properly filling in excavated areas around newly installed or repaired underground utilities, foundations, or drainage systems. This service ensures that the soil is compacted correctly to provide stability, support, and protection for the infrastructure beneath the surface. Proper backfill not only restores the ground’s appearance but also helps prevent future settling, shifting, or damage that can compromise the integrity of the property or its systems.

These services help address common problems such as uneven ground settling, erosion, and structural instability. When excavations are not properly backfilled, properties can experience issues like cracks in foundations, uneven surfaces, or drainage problems. By ensuring that the backfill material is appropriately selected and compacted, property owners can reduce the risk of costly repairs and maintain the safety and functionality of their outdoor spaces and underground systems.

Labor Costs - Backfill installation labor typically ranges from $50 to $100 per hour, depending on project complexity and local rates. For a standard job, total labor costs often fall between $200 and $600.

Material Expenses - The cost of backfill materials such as gravel or soil generally varies from $10 to $30 per cubic yard. Larger projects can incur material costs of $100 to $300 or more, depending on volume.

Equipment Fees - Equipment rental or usage fees for backfill installation usually add $50 to $150 to the overall cost. These fees depend on the machinery required, like excavators or compactors.

Additional Charges - Extra services such as site preparation or disposal of existing materials may increase costs by $100 to $400. Exact charges depend on project size and specific site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is backfill installation? Backfill installation involves filling in excavated areas around foundations, pipes, or other underground structures to provide stability and support.

Why is proper backfill important? Proper backfill helps prevent settling, shifting, or damage to underground structures, ensuring long-term stability.

What materials are used for backfill? Common backfill materials include soil, gravel, or a combination, selected based on project requirements and site conditions.
